       AN ACT to amend the executive law, in relation to unlawful discriminato-
         ry practices in housing based on lawful source of income
         THE PEOPLE OF THE STATE OF NEW YORK, REPRESENTED IN SENATE AND  ASSEM-
       BLY, DO ENACT AS FOLLOWS:
    1    Section 1. Section 292 of the executive law is amended by adding a new
    2  subdivision 34 to read as follows:
    3    34.  THE  TERM  "LAWFUL  SOURCE  OF  INCOME" SHALL INCLUDE, BUT NOT BE
    4  LIMITED TO, THE FEDERAL HOUSING SUBSIDY KNOWN AS "SECTION EIGHT".
    5    S 2. Paragraphs (a), (b), (c) and (c-1) of subdivision 2-a of  section
    6  296  of  the  executive  law, paragraphs (a), (b) and (c) as amended and
    7  paragraph (c-1) as added by chapter 106 of the laws of 2003, are amended
    8  to read as follows:
    9    (a) To refuse to sell, rent or lease or otherwise to deny to or  with-
   10  hold  from  any  person  or group of persons such housing accommodations
   11  because of the race, creed, color, disability, national  origin,  sexual
   12  orientation, military status, age, sex, marital status, LAWFUL SOURCE OF
   13  INCOME  or  familial  status  of such person or persons, or to represent
   14  that any housing accommodation or land is not available for  inspection,
   15  sale, rental or lease when in fact it is so available.
   16    (b)  To  discriminate  against  any person because of his or her race,
   17  creed, color, disability, national origin, sexual orientation,  military
   18  status,  age,  sex,  marital status, LAWFUL SOURCE OF INCOME or familial
   19  status in the terms, conditions or privileges of  any  publicly-assisted
   20  housing accommodations or in the furnishing of facilities or services in
   21  connection therewith.
   22    (c) To cause to be made any written or oral inquiry or record concern-
   23  ing  the  race, creed, color, disability, national origin, sexual orien-

    1  tation, membership in the reserve armed forces of the United  States  or
    2  in  the organized militia of the state, age, sex, marital status, LAWFUL
    3  SOURCE OF INCOME or familial status of a person seeking to rent or lease
    4  any  publicly-assisted  housing  accommodation;  provided, however, that
    5  nothing in this subdivision shall prohibit a member of the reserve armed
    6  forces of the United States or in the organized  militia  of  the  state
    7  from voluntarily disclosing such membership.
    8    (c-1)  To  print or circulate or cause to be printed or circulated any
    9  statement, advertisement or publication, or to use any form of  applica-
   10  tion  for the purchase, rental or lease of such housing accommodation or
   11  to make any  record  or  inquiry  in  connection  with  the  prospective
   12  purchase,  rental  or  lease  of  such  a  housing  accommodation  which
   13  expresses, directly or  indirectly,  any  limitation,  specification  or
   14  discrimination  as to race, creed, color, national origin, sexual orien-
   15  tation, military status, sex, age, disability,  marital  status,  LAWFUL
   16  SOURCE  OF  INCOME  or  familial  status, or any intent to make any such
   17  limitation, specification or discrimination.
   18    S 3. Subparagraphs 1, 2 and 3 of paragraph (a)  of  subdivision  5  of
   19  section  296 of the executive law, as amended by chapter 106 of the laws
   20  of 2003, are amended to read as follows:
   21    (1) To refuse to sell, rent, lease or otherwise to deny to or withhold
   22  from any person or group of persons such a housing accommodation because
   23  of the race, creed, color, national origin, sexual orientation, military
   24  status, sex, age, disability, marital status, LAWFUL SOURCE OF INCOME or
   25  familial status of such person or persons,  or  to  represent  that  any
   26  housing  accommodation  or  land  is not available for inspection, sale,
   27  rental or lease when in fact it is so available.
   28    (2) To discriminate against any person because of race, creed,  color,
   29  national origin, sexual orientation, military status, sex, age, disabil-
   30  ity,  marital  status, LAWFUL SOURCE OF INCOME or familial status in the
   31  terms, conditions or privileges of the sale, rental or lease of any such
   32  housing accommodation or in the furnishing of facilities or services  in
   33  connection therewith.
   34    (3)  To  print  or  circulate or cause to be printed or circulated any
   35  statement, advertisement or publication, or to use any form of  applica-
   36  tion  for the purchase, rental or lease of such housing accommodation or
   37  to make any  record  or  inquiry  in  connection  with  the  prospective
   38  purchase,  rental  or  lease  of  such  a  housing  accommodation  which
   39  expresses, directly or  indirectly,  any  limitation,  specification  or
   40  discrimination  as to race, creed, color, national origin, sexual orien-
   41  tation, military status, sex, age, disability,  marital  status,  LAWFUL
   42  SOURCE  OF  INCOME  or  familial  status, or any intent to make any such
   43  limitation, specification or discrimination.
   44    S 4. Subdivision 20 of section 296 of the executive law, as renumbered
   45  by chapter 204 of the laws of 1996, is renumbered subdivision 21  and  a
   46  new subdivision 20 is added to read as follows:
   47    20.  THE  PROVISIONS  OF  THIS SUBDIVISION, AS THEY RELATE TO UNLAWFUL
   48  DISCRIMINATORY PRACTICES ON THE BASIS OF LAWFUL SOURCE OF INCOME,  SHALL
   49  NOT  APPLY  TO  HOUSING  ACCOMMODATIONS  THAT CONTAIN A TOTAL OF FIVE OR
   50  FEWER HOUSING UNITS, PROVIDED, HOWEVER:
   51    (A) THE PROVISIONS OF THIS SUBDIVISION SHALL APPLY TO TENANTS  SUBJECT
   52  TO RENT CONTROL LAWS WHO RESIDE IN HOUSING ACCOMMODATIONS THAT CONTAIN A
   53  TOTAL  OF  FIVE OR FEWER UNITS AS OF THE EFFECTIVE DATE OF THIS SUBDIVI-
   54  SION; AND PROVIDED, HOWEVER:
   55    (B) THE PROVISIONS OF THIS SUBDIVISION  SHALL  APPLY  TO  ALL  HOUSING
   56  ACCOMMODATIONS,  REGARDLESS OF THE NUMBER OF UNITS CONTAINED IN EACH, OF

    1  ANY PERSON WHO HAS THE RIGHT TO SELL, RENT OR LEASE OR APPROVE THE SALE,
    2  RENTAL OR LEASE OF AT LEAST ONE HOUSING ACCOMMODATION  WITHIN  NEW  YORK
    3  STATE  THAT  CONTAINS  SIX  OR  MORE HOUSING UNITS, CONSTRUCTED OR TO BE
    4  CONSTRUCTED, OR AN INTEREST THEREIN.
    5    S  5.  The  executive  law is amended by adding a new section 298-b to
    6  read as follows:
    7    S 298-B. PUNITIVE PENALTIES FOR CERTAIN VIOLATIONS.    NOTWITHSTANDING
    8  ANY  PROVISION  OF LAW TO THE CONTRARY, IN ANY FINDING OF A VIOLATION OF
    9  SUBDIVISION TWO-A OR SUBDIVISION FIVE OF SECTION TWO HUNDRED  NINETY-SIX
   10  OF  THIS  ARTICLE,  WHERE  SUCH VIOLATION INVOLVES DISCRIMINATION ON THE
   11  BASIS OF LAWFUL SOURCE OF INCOME THE COMMISSIONER SHALL IMPOSE  A  PUNI-
   12  TIVE  PENALTY  OF NOT LESS THAN TWENTY-FIVE HUNDRED DOLLARS AND NOT MORE
   13  THAN FIVE THOUSAND DOLLARS AGAINST THE OWNER, LESSEE, SUB-LESSEE, ASSIG-
   14  NEE, OR MANAGING AGENT OF SUCH HOUSING ACCOMMODATION FOUND IN VIOLATION.
   15    S 6. This act shall take effect immediately and  shall  apply  to  all
   16  causes of action filed on and after such effective date.
